information about the author of Ephesians 6:4

The most-likely author of Ephesians 6:4 is the apostle Paul. Paul was a prolific writer of the New Testament, credited with authoring many of the letters contained in the Bible. He was a passionate follower of Jesus Christ and played a significant role in spreading the gospel to the early Christian communities.

From an evangelical Christian perspective, Paul’s writing in Ephesians 6:4 emphasizes the importance of family relationships, specifically the role of fathers in raising their children in a way that honors and reflects the teachings of Jesus. The verse instructs fathers not to provoke their children to anger, but to bring them up in the discipline and instruction of the Lord.

This verse is often interpreted as emphasizing the responsibility of fathers to lead their families spiritually and provide a positive and loving example for their children. It highlights the importance of intentional and purposeful parenting that is rooted in the principles of the Christian faith.

Overall, believers from an evangelical Christian perspective view Paul as a faithful servant of God who dedicated his life to spreading the message of salvation through Jesus Christ. His words in Ephesians 6:4 are considered timeless guidance for parents seeking to raise their children in a way that honors God.
